This class encompasses various types of parameterized variational inequalities/generalized equations with fairly general constraint sets. The new condition requires computation of directional limiting coderivatives of the normal-cone mapping for the so-called critical directions. The respective formulas have the form of a second-order chain rule and extend the available calculus of directional limiting objects. The suggested procedure is illustrated by means of examples.</abstract>     <RIV>BA</RIV> <FORD0>10000</FORD0> <FORD1>10100</FORD1> <FORD2>10102</FORD2>    <reportyear>2018</reportyear>     <inst_support> RVO:67985556 </inst_support>  <permalink>http://hdl.handle.net/11104/0275510</permalink>   <confidential>S</confidential>  <unknown tag="mrcbC86"> 1 Article|Proceedings Paper Operations Research Management Science|Mathematics Applied  </unknown> <unknown tag="mrcbC86"> 1 Article|Proceedings Paper Operations Research Management Science|Mathematics Applied  </unknown> <unknown tag="mrcbC86"> 1 Article|Proceedings Paper Operations Research Management Science|Mathematics Applied  </unknown>         <unknown tag="mrcbT16-e">MATHEMATICS.APPLIED|OPERATIONSRESEARCH&amp;MANAGEMENTSCIENCE</unknown> <unknown tag="mrcbT16-f">0.956</unknown> <unknown tag="mrcbT16-g">0.234</unknown> <unknown tag="mrcbT16-h">10.9</unknown> <unknown tag="mrcbT16-i">0.00158</unknown> <unknown tag="mrcbT16-j">0.629</unknown> <unknown tag="mrcbT16-k">931</unknown> <unknown tag="mrcbT16-s">0.688</unknown> <unknown tag="mrcbT16-5">0.800</unknown> <unknown tag="mrcbT16-6">47</unknown> <unknown tag="mrcbT16-7">Q3</unknown> <unknown tag="mrcbT16-B">42.258</unknown> <unknown tag="mrcbT16-C">27.4</unknown> <unknown tag="mrcbT16-D">Q3</unknown> <unknown tag="mrcbT16-E">Q2</unknown> <unknown tag="mrcbT16-M">0.49</unknown> <unknown tag="mrcbT16-N">Q3</unknown> <unknown tag="mrcbT16-P">37.5</unknown> <arlyear>2017</arlyear>       <unknown tag="mrcbU14"> 85021295338 SCOPUS </unknown> <unknown tag="mrcbU24"> PUBMED </unknown> <unknown tag="mrcbU34"> 000423125800002 WOS </unknown> <unknown tag="mrcbU63"> cav_un_epca*0254275 Mathematical Methods of Operations Research 1432-2994 1432-5217 Roč. 86 č. 3 2017 443 467 Springer </unknown> </cas_special> </bibitem>
